Mission Statement

Student Disability Services (SDS) serves the University of Iowa’s commitment to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ion by providing support and academic accommodations for students with disabilities. SDS collaborates with students, faculty, and staff to create an accessible educational environment for all. We welcome, encourage, and empower the students we serve. SDS builds awareness of issues related to accessibility within the University of Iowa community.

About Student Disability Services

Equal access to education is achieved when barriers to learning are removed and students with disabilities are allowed to compete solely on the basis of their academic skills and abilities. Student Disability Services (SDS) strives to ensure a fair learning environment where students are able to succeed based on their own efforts and initiative, and staff members work with students, faculty, and other university resources to coordinate accommodations for entitled students under federal legislation.

Key Statistics

1,195

Number of students who used SDS services.

35%

Percentage of students who utilized Student Disability Services with ADHD.

20%

Percentage of students who utilized Student Disability Services with a learning disability.
